Google News May Be Biased Towards Conservatives

In the world of automated aggregation, can there be a general tendency to lean to one side or t’other of the political spectrum? Perhaps. Online Journalism Review takes Google Chief Scientist Krishna Bharat to task on why this might be.

[A] possible factor… is that small, alternative news sites have no hesitancy about using “John Kerry” in a headline, while most mainstream news sites eschew first names in headlines. The inadvertent result is that the smaller sites score better results with the search engines.
